From "Stick & Stones" Reggae Slot on Fresno’s KFSR 90.7FM in 1989, to Reggae Concert Promoter with Wendy Russell Productions in 1990, it was decided unanimously that Stone needed to be on the Decks with his knowledge and personal style as DJ Professor Stone. With his favorite influences at that time, Mad Professor and Stone Love, DJ Professor Stone was born.Running One of Fresno’s Longest Reggae Residencies "Rebel Dance", you would find DJ Professor Stone in infamous Venues such as Bogeys, Nite Flite, Express, The Wild Blue & Soho. In 1997, a romantic encounter with a professional Ballet Dancer, met on a Seattle Tour, influenced Stone to move to Nashville Tennessee to pursue her Professional career. In just months, Stone would be kicking off a career of his own, opening up for acts like Michael Rose @ Tommy Guns and then bringing his weekly "Rebel Dance" to the Lava Lounge where he teamed up with Tennessee’s Local Caribbean Radio Host "Uncle L". Career moves brought Stone to Portland, Oregon in late 1999 where he joined DJ Unity, G Wax, Short Change and several others and learned that Portland was where he would put his Roots down for a bit. After 2 or so years of feeling out the beat in the PDX Scene, Stone Linked up with Manoj Mathews (PDX Electronic Music Guru) & Stephen Brenbrook (Zion’s Gate Records, Seattle) helping Stone open his own Zion’s Gate Records in Portland, OR. Through this, many other great reputable projects were born and hosted by the Zion’s Gate Crew for many years until physical DJ specialty shops became obsolete via internet. From this, it was time to make more moves and, shortly after, Stone was booking, as well as DJing, all over the West Coast pursuing his own personal career and helping kick off and spearhead many others as well. Back in the day you could catch one of Stone’s sets at a Mix Master Mike Show, or Prince Paul, Swamp, Z Trip show! But Stone’s Diversity and Love for this game would have him opening up for Rob Paine, Jay Jay Hernandez or Garth on one side of town, one night, and then Burning Spear, Mikey Dread or EEk A Mouse, at another! It was true; Stone was consistent in bringing forth uplifting and funky refreshing creative sets in any genre!
